- What is this tool?
- Agricolus is a platform that provides yield forecasting and risk analytics to help farmers optimize crop production.
- How much does it cost?
- Agricolus offers a free tier with basic features; pricing for advanced features is not publicly detailed.
- Does it have a free plan?
- Yes, Agricolus provides a free plan with limited forecasting and analytics capabilities.
- What integrations does it support?
- There is no public information on integrations or API support currently available.
- Who is it best for?
- It is best suited for farmers and agronomists focused on improving crop yields through data-driven insights.
- What is this tool?
- Cropwise AI integrates multiple agricultural data sources to provide actionable crop health insights for growers and agronomists.
- How much does it cost?
- Pricing is custom and available on an enterprise basis tailored to large-scale agricultural operations.
- Does it have a free plan?
- No, Cropwise AI does not offer a free plan.
- What integrations does it support?
- It integrates field data, satellite imagery, weather data, and farm management inputs.
- Who is it best for?
- It is best suited for enterprise agronomists and large-scale growers needing comprehensive crop health monitoring.

Cropwise AI has an overall score of 5/10 and offers enterprise-level pricing, targeting larger-scale agricultural operations with advanced features suited for comprehensive farm management. Agricolus scores slightly higher at 5.1/10 and provides a freemium pricing model, making it accessible for smaller farms or users seeking basic functionalities with the option to upgrade for more advanced tools. The pricing structures reflect their differing approaches to user accessibility and scalability.
